
Disney’s monorail systems have been a memorable part of visiting the theme parks since the original Disneyland monorail system opened in 1959. In the years since, the system has been expanded to Walt Disney World and the Tokyo Disney Resort, and has grown to enjoy a massive following of fans.
The look of Disney’s monorails is certainly iconic, from the original Disneyland Alweg system to the Mark VI trains Guests currently take to reach the Magic Kingdom, EPCOT, Disney’s Contemporary Resort, Disney’s Polynesian Village Resort, and Disney’s Grand Floridian Resort & Spa. The Disneyland monorail just debuted its new look to help kick off the Disney100 celebration. The Walt Disney Company is celebrating its 100th anniversary in 2023, and the Disneyland Resort will serve as the center of many of the festivities.
We’ve already seen the Resort debut new decor around the theme parks, and are excited to see how Sleeping Beauty Castle looks all dressed up for the occasion. The Disneyland monorail’s new look for Disney100 has already arrived, and includes a stunning platinum-inspired wrap with favorite characters:

Disney100 officially begins this week, with special experiences planned for Disney Parks around the world and ways for fans to get involved from home. As the Disneyland Resort, the celebration also kicks off with the official opening of Mickey & Minnie’s Runaway Railway in the newly reimagined Toontown at Disneyland Park.
